打开页面即执行的JavaScript 原理、应用与优化策略这个标题涵盖了您要求的互联网技术关键词,并且围绕该关键词进行了深入研究、逻辑构建和专业写作。

原创
2024/08/30 17:58
阅读数 53

① 询问构建

询问:在Web开发中,打开页面即执行的JavaScript是如何实现的?其背后的原理是什么?在实际应用中,有哪些优化策略可以提高页面加载速度和用户体验?

② 文章撰写

文章标题:打开页面即执行的JavaScript 原理、应用与优化策略

文章摘要:本文将深入探讨打开页面即执行的JavaScript的原理,分析其在实际应用中的作用,并介绍一些优化策略,以提高页面加载速度和用户体验。

一、打开页面即执行的JavaScript的原理

打开页面即执行的JavaScript通常是指在用户打开Web页面时,JavaScript代码立即执行。这通常通过在HTML页面的或标签中插入标签来实现。这些脚本在浏览器解析HTML时执行,因此,它们可以在页面完全加载之前或加载过程中运行。

JavaScript的解析和执行是由浏览器的JavaScript引擎完成的。当浏览器遇到标签时,它会暂停HTML的解析,将控制权交给JavaScript引擎,等待JavaScript代码执行完毕后再恢复HTML的解析。

二、打开页面即执行的JavaScript的应用

打开页面即执行的JavaScript在Web开发中有着广泛的应用。例如,它可以用于:

  1. 页面初始化:设置初始状态,如设置默认选项、初始化动画等。
  2. 加载数据:从服务器获取数据并更新页面内容。
  3. 追踪用户行为:收集用户数据,如点击事件、滚动事件等。

三、打开页面即执行的JavaScript的优化策略

尽管打开页面即执行的JavaScript在许多情况下非常有用,但它也可能导致页面加载速度变慢,影响用户体验。以下是一些优化策略:

  1. 延迟加载:将JavaScript代码放在标签的底部,以确保在需要时加载,而不是在页面初始化时立即加载。

  2. 异步加载:使用async或defer属性,使JavaScript在后台加载,而不会阻塞HTML的解析。

  3. 压缩和合并:使用工具将JavaScript代码压缩和合并,以减少文件大小和加载时间。

  4. 使用CDN:将JavaScript代码托管在内容分发网络(CDN)上,以加快加载速度。

  5. 缓存:使用浏览器缓存,减少重复请求JavaScript文件。

总结:

打开页面即执行的JavaScript在Web开发中起着重要的作用,但它也可能对页面加载速度产生负面影响。通过采用上述优化策略,我们可以提高页面加载速度和用户体验,同时保持JavaScript的功能性。在未来的Web开发中,我们需要平衡JavaScript的功能性和性能,以创建更快速、更高效的Web应用。

展开阅读全文
加载中
点击引领话题📣 发布并加入讨论🔥
0 评论
0 收藏
0
分享
返回顶部
顶部